Group commends AbdulRazaq over choice of cabinet members
1.6k
VIEWS
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Whatsapp
The Diaspora and Nigeria Youth Initiative (DNYI) has commended Gov. A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q of Kwara over his choice of new cabinet members in the state.
This is contained in a statement issued in Ilorin on Sunday by the National Coordinator of DNYI, Mr Ishola Maruf.
The statement described the cabinet as an assemblage of technocrats, bureaucrats, boardroom gurus and academics.
It congratulated the cabinet appointees on their successful inauguration, urging them to be steadfast and resolute in teaming up with the governor to achieve the vision and mission of turning Kwara into a better place anyone can be proud of.
“We wish to commend our amiable governor and NGF Chairman, for carefully selected cabinet members which cut across all spheres, setting standard as far as inclusivity in governance is concerned.
“The team is indeed a star studded one which we are confident would hit the ground running to drive the policies and programs of the present administration.
“The cabinet members comprises technocrats, bureaucrats, boardroom gurus, fifty per cent women and also people living with disabilities.
“It shows that Gov. AbdulRazaq has set the standard for all other states in Nigeria and beyond to follow in line with international best practices,” the statement read in part.
It however solicited the support of the public and stakeholders in order to assist the governor to take Kwara to a promise land.
The statement said DNYI is a body of Nigerian youths in Canada, North America and other countries who are doing well and making the country proud.
